Pros & Cons

Onkyo TX-RZ820

VS

Pros

    • It is convenient to download a digital version and control it via my tablet. Moreover, music selection and playback are built into the app.
    • I am not an avid FM listener, but I was amazed. Despite stations were distant away, the reception was flawless.
    • Also, I connected it to Apple TV without problems to watch a couple of shots.
    • Network audio player pleasantly surprised me.
    • Good quality of the output audio – due to various enhancement technologies (plus it

Cons

    • he Onkyo privacy bothered me. It constantly popped up. ‘Not to Accept’ option didn’t help. It appeared every time when I switched a channel.
    • Slightly confusing interface. It was not clear what to choose because my speakers are directly connected to the receiver and I’m not used to it.
    • Some customers have issues with Samsung Bluray players (no video output).
    • Issues with the HDMI signal (it cuts out with 4K sources).
